1.1. Job Market Outlook for Auto Technicians

The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) projects a steady demand for automotive service technicians and mechanics. Factors such as the increasing number of vehicles on the road and advancements in automotive technology contribute to this sustained need. According to the BLS, the median annual wage for automotive service technicians and mechanics was $46,840 in May 2021. The top 10 percent earned more than $78,000. These figures underscore the financial potential of a career in auto repair.

2. Essential Skills for Auto Repair Technicians

To thrive in the auto repair industry, technicians must possess a combination of technical skills and soft skills. These competencies enable them to diagnose and repair vehicles efficiently, communicate effectively with customers, and adapt to evolving automotive technologies.

2.1. Technical Expertise

A strong foundation in automotive technology is crucial. This includes understanding engine mechanics, electrical systems, computer diagnostics, and hydraulic systems. Technicians should be proficient in using diagnostic tools, repair manuals, and other resources to accurately identify and resolve vehicle issues. Ongoing training and certification, such as ASE certification, are essential for staying current with industry advancements.

2.2. Diagnostic and Problem-Solving Abilities

Effective diagnostics are at the heart of auto repair. Technicians must be able to systematically analyze vehicle symptoms, use diagnostic equipment to pinpoint problems, and develop efficient repair strategies. Strong problem-solving skills are essential for tackling complex issues and ensuring accurate repairs.

2.3. Customer Service and Communication Skills

Excellent customer service is vital for building trust and loyalty. Technicians should be able to clearly explain technical issues to customers, provide accurate estimates, and address any concerns or questions. Effective communication skills enhance customer satisfaction and contribute to a positive shop reputation.

2.4. Adaptability and Continuous Learning

The automotive industry is constantly evolving, with new technologies and systems being introduced regularly. Technicians must be adaptable and committed to continuous learning to keep pace with these changes. This includes participating in training programs, attending workshops, and staying informed about industry trends.

3. Auto Repair Training Programs: Finding the Right Fit

Choosing the right auto repair training program is a critical first step toward a successful career. Various options are available, ranging from vocational schools to community colleges and online courses. Evaluating these programs based on their curriculum, accreditation, and career support services is essential.

3.1. Vocational Schools

Vocational schools offer focused, hands-on training in auto repair. These programs typically provide a comprehensive curriculum covering various aspects of automotive technology, diagnostics, and repair. Vocational schools often have strong ties with local auto shops, providing students with valuable internship and job placement opportunities.

3.2. Community Colleges

Community colleges offer associate’s degrees in automotive technology. These programs provide a broader education, including general studies courses alongside technical training. Community college programs can be a good option for students seeking a more comprehensive academic foundation.

3.3. Online Auto Repair Courses

Online auto repair courses offer flexibility and convenience, allowing students to learn at their own pace and on their own schedule. These courses can be a good option for individuals who need to balance their studies with work or other commitments. However, hands-on experience is critical in auto repair, so online courses should be supplemented with practical training.

3.4. Evaluating Training Programs

When evaluating auto repair training programs, consider the following factors:

  • Accreditation: Ensure the program is accredited by a reputable organization, such as the ASE Education Foundation. Accreditation indicates that the program meets industry standards and provides quality education.
  • Curriculum: Review the curriculum to ensure it covers essential topics such as engine repair, electrical systems, diagnostics, and computer controls.
  • Instructors: Look for experienced instructors with industry certifications and a proven track record of success.
  • Facilities and Equipment: Visit the school’s facilities to ensure they are well-equipped with modern diagnostic tools and repair equipment.
  • Career Support Services: Inquire about the program’s career support services, such as job placement assistance, resume writing workshops, and interview preparation.

3.5. Cost and Financial Aid

Auto repair training programs can vary significantly in cost. Research tuition fees, equipment costs, and other expenses. Explore financial aid options such as scholarships, grants, and student loans to help finance your education.

4. ASE Certification: Validating Your Expertise

ASE (Automotive Service Excellence) certification is a widely recognized industry credential that validates a technician’s knowledge and skills. Achieving ASE certification can enhance your credibility, improve your job prospects, and increase your earning potential.

4.1. Benefits of ASE Certification

ASE certification demonstrates your commitment to professionalism and excellence in auto repair. Certified technicians are often preferred by employers and customers alike. ASE certification can also lead to higher wages and increased career opportunities.

4.2. Types of ASE Certifications

ASE offers certifications in various areas of automotive repair, including:

  • Engine Repair
  • Electrical/Electronic Systems
  • Brakes
  • Suspension and Steering
  • Heating and Air Conditioning
  • Engine Performance
  • Automatic Transmission/Transaxle
  • Manual Drive Train and Axles

4.3. Preparing for ASE Exams

To prepare for ASE exams, consider the following:

  • Study Materials: Obtain ASE study guides and practice exams to review key concepts and test your knowledge.
  • Training Courses: Enroll in ASE preparation courses offered by vocational schools and community colleges.
  • Hands-On Experience: Gain practical experience by working in an auto shop or completing internships.

4.4. Maintaining Your Certification

ASE certifications are valid for five years. To maintain your certification, you must retake the exams before the expiration date. This ensures that certified technicians stay current with industry advancements and maintain their expertise.

5. Opening Your Own Auto Repair Shop in San Marcos

For those with entrepreneurial aspirations, opening an auto repair shop in San Marcos can be a rewarding venture. However, it requires careful planning, significant investment, and a strong understanding of business management principles.

5.1. Developing a Business Plan

A well-developed business plan is essential for securing funding, guiding your business decisions, and attracting investors. Your business plan should include the following:

  • Executive Summary: A brief overview of your business concept, goals, and strategies.
  • Company Description: Detailed information about your shop, including its mission, vision, and values.
  • Market Analysis: An assessment of the auto repair market in San Marcos, including your target customers, competitors, and market trends.
  • Services Offered: A description of the services you will provide, such as routine maintenance, diagnostics, and repairs.
  • Marketing and Sales Strategy: A plan for attracting and retaining customers, including advertising, promotions, and customer service initiatives.
  • Management Team: Information about your management team and their experience and qualifications.
  • Financial Projections: Realistic financial forecasts, including startup costs, revenue projections, and profitability analysis.

5.2. Securing Funding

Opening an auto repair shop requires significant capital. Explore funding options such as:

  • Small Business Loans: Loans from banks and credit unions specifically designed for small businesses.
  • SBA Loans: Loans guaranteed by the Small Business Administration (SBA), which can make it easier to qualify for financing.
  • Personal Savings: Using your own savings to fund part of your startup costs.
  • Investors: Seeking investments from friends, family, or venture capitalists.

5.3. Choosing a Location

The location of your auto repair shop is critical to its success. Consider factors such as:

  • Visibility: Choose a location with high visibility and easy access for customers.
  • Traffic: Look for areas with high traffic volume and a significant number of registered vehicles.
  • Competition: Assess the number and location of competing auto shops in the area.
  • Zoning Regulations: Ensure the location is properly zoned for auto repair businesses.
  • Lease Terms: Negotiate favorable lease terms with the landlord.

5.4. Obtaining Licenses and Permits

Operating an auto repair shop requires various licenses and permits, including:

  • Business License: A general business license from the city of San Marcos.
  • Auto Repair License: A specific license for auto repair businesses from the state of California.
  • Environmental Permits: Permits related to waste disposal and environmental compliance.
  • Building Permits: Permits for any construction or renovation work.

5.5. Equipping Your Shop

Investing in quality equipment is essential for providing efficient and reliable auto repair services. Essential equipment includes:

  • Diagnostic Scanners: For diagnosing vehicle problems.
  • Lifts: For raising vehicles to perform repairs.
  • Air Compressors: For powering pneumatic tools.
  • Welding Equipment: For welding repairs.
  • Brake Lathes: For machining brake rotors and drums.
  • Tire Changers and Balancers: For tire services.

5.6. Hiring and Managing Staff

Hiring skilled and reliable staff is crucial for the success of your auto repair shop. Look for technicians with ASE certifications and a proven track record of success. Provide ongoing training and development opportunities to keep your staff up-to-date with industry advancements.

5.7. Marketing Your Business

Effective marketing is essential for attracting and retaining customers. Consider the following marketing strategies:

  • Website: Create a professional website with information about your services, location, and contact details.
  • Online Advertising: Use online advertising platforms such as Google Ads and social media to reach potential customers.
  • Local SEO: Optimize your website and online listings for local search to attract customers in San Marcos.
  • Print Advertising: Use print advertising in local newspapers and magazines.
  • Direct Mail: Send direct mail pieces to residents in the area.
  • Customer Referrals: Encourage satisfied customers to refer their friends and family.

7.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them

Both auto repair technicians and shop owners face various challenges. Being aware of these challenges and developing strategies to overcome them is crucial for success.

7.1. Keeping Up with Technology

The automotive industry is constantly evolving, with new technologies and systems being introduced regularly. Technicians must commit to continuous learning to keep pace with these changes.

Solution:

  • Participate in training programs and workshops.
  • Stay informed about industry trends through trade publications and online resources.
  • Invest in diagnostic tools and equipment that can handle the latest technologies.

7.2. Attracting and Retaining Customers

Attracting and retaining customers is essential for the success of any auto repair shop. Competition can be fierce, and customers have many choices.

Solution:

  • Provide excellent customer service.
  • Offer competitive pricing.
  • Build a strong reputation through word-of-mouth referrals.
  • Use effective marketing strategies to reach potential customers.

7.3. Managing Finances

Managing finances effectively is crucial for the long-term sustainability of your business. This includes budgeting, tracking expenses, and managing cash flow.

Solution:

  • Develop a detailed budget and track your expenses regularly.
  • Use accounting software to manage your finances.
  • Seek advice from a financial advisor or accountant.

7.4. Dealing with Difficult Customers

Dealing with difficult customers is an inevitable part of running an auto repair shop. It’s important to handle these situations professionally and resolve any issues to the customer’s satisfaction.

Solution:

  • Listen to the customer’s concerns and empathize with their situation.
  • Clearly explain the problem and the steps you are taking to resolve it.
  • Offer a fair and reasonable solution.
  • Document all interactions with the customer.
